Have you considered biking? If the terrain is somewhat flat I guess it would take about half the time, and you will get daily, light exercise as an added bonus.
Edit: Also, I would be interested to know how long it would take by bike if you happen to know :-)
Edit: Also, I would be interested to know how long it would take by bike if you happen to know :-)